In that case, we should return setup_data containing the absolute addresses that are hard coded and determined a priori. This is the case when kernels are loaded by BIOS, for example. In contrast, when setup_data is read as a file, then we shouldn't modify setup_data, since the absolute address will be wrong by definition. This is the case when OVMF loads the image. This allows setup_data to be used like normal, without crashing when EFI tries to use it.
